The Prichard Family Foundation

Dallas, Texas  ·  EIN 742891651  ·  Private foundation

Based in Dallas, Texas, The Prichard Family Foundation has awarded $3.1M across 107 grants in our index of public IRS filings, with giving recorded as recently as 2025. Its largest grant on record went to Baylor University. This profile covers its focus areas, top grant recipients, year-by-year giving, and how a nonprofit should approach it.

What The Prichard Family Foundation funds

The Prichard Family Foundation's giving carries a documented focus on arts & culture, education, faith-based (christian), health care, higher education, and related causes.

Populations it has supported include children, families, foster youth, men boys, women girls.

How to apply for funding from The Prichard Family Foundation

The Prichard Family Foundation's public IRS filing does not spell out a formal application process. Foundations of this size often give primarily to organizations they already know, so a concise letter of inquiry or a warm introduction is usually the best first contact — not a full proposal.
